What Are the Essential Features of a Helmet for Motorcycle Drag Racing?
The essential features of a helmet for motorcycle drag racing are crucial for ensuring safety and performance during high-speed events.
- Snell Certification: A helmet that meets Snell certification standards is essential for drag racing as it ensures the helmet can withstand the high impact forces typically encountered in crashes.
- Aerodynamic Design: An aerodynamic shape reduces drag and helps maintain stability at high speeds, which is critical during drag racing where every millisecond counts.
- Visor Quality: A high-quality visor with anti-fog and scratch-resistant properties is important for maintaining clear visibility during races, especially under varying weather conditions.
- Comfort and Fit: A well-fitted helmet with adequate padding provides comfort for the rider, which is vital during long races, preventing distractions that could lead to mistakes.
- Ventilation: Effective ventilation systems help to regulate temperature and moisture inside the helmet, allowing riders to stay cool and focused during intense drag racing competitions.
The Snell certification is a critical feature for any racing helmet, as it represents a rigorous testing standard that ensures the helmet can handle the extreme conditions of a crash. Helmets that have passed Snell tests have been evaluated for their impact resistance and structural integrity, making them a preferred choice for serious racers.
An aerodynamic design is not just about aesthetics; it plays a pivotal role in enhancing performance by minimizing air resistance. This design feature helps riders maintain a streamlined profile, which is especially important when racing against the clock in drag events.
The visor of the helmet must be of high quality to ensure that it remains clear and functional throughout the race. Features like anti-fog coatings and scratch resistance are essential, as they maintain visibility regardless of speed or environmental factors such as rain or dust.
Comfort and fit are paramount since a helmet that doesn’t fit well can cause discomfort or even distraction. A properly fitted helmet provides stability and allows the rider to concentrate fully on the race without being hindered by unnecessary movement or pressure points.
Lastly, ventilation is crucial for maintaining comfort during high-intensity racing. A helmet with a well-designed ventilation system helps to circulate air, preventing overheating and allowing the rider to maintain focus throughout the race by reducing fatigue caused by heat buildup.

What Safety Certifications Should You Look for in a Motorcycle Drag Racing Helmet?
When searching for the best helmet for motorcycle drag racing, it is crucial to consider specific safety certifications that ensure the helmet meets industry standards.
- DOT (Department of Transportation): This certification indicates that the helmet has passed rigorous testing for impact resistance, penetration, and retention system effectiveness, making it a legal requirement for street use in the United States.
- ECE (Economic Commission for Europe): The ECE certification is recognized internationally and ensures that the helmet meets safety standards similar to those of DOT, focusing on performance during crashes and overall design to protect the rider.
- Snell Memorial Foundation: Snell certifications are more stringent than DOT or ECE and are specifically designed for high-impact sports, including motorcycle racing. Helmets with Snell certification undergo additional testing for impact and retention, providing a higher level of protection.
- FIM (Fédération Internationale de Motocyclisme): FIM certification is essential for professional racing and indicates that the helmet meets the highest standards of safety and performance required in competitive motorsports, including drag racing events.
- SHARP (Safety Helmet Assessment and Rating Programme): Although primarily used in the UK, SHARP provides additional safety ratings for helmets based on their performance in impact tests, helping consumers identify helmets that offer superior protection.
- ISO (International Organization for Standardization): ISO certifications, particularly ISO 9001, ensure that the helmet manufacturer follows strict quality management protocols, leading to consistent product quality and performance.
What Materials Provide the Best Protection for Drag Racing Helmets?
The materials that provide the best protection for drag racing helmets are crucial for ensuring safety and performance during high-speed races.
- Carbon Fiber: Carbon fiber is renowned for its high strength-to-weight ratio, making it an excellent choice for drag racing helmets. It offers superior impact resistance and rigidity while remaining lightweight, which is essential for reducing fatigue during extended races.
- Fiberglass: Fiberglass helmets are commonly used in drag racing due to their durability and affordability. They provide good protection against impacts while being heavier than carbon fiber, but they still maintain a balance between safety and comfort.
- Kevlar: Kevlar is another advanced material often used in high-performance helmets. Known for its exceptional tensile strength, Kevlar helmets offer excellent protection against abrasions and impacts, making them suitable for the intense conditions of drag racing.
- Polycarbonate: Polycarbonate is a thermoplastic material that is often used for budget-friendly helmets. While not as strong as carbon fiber or Kevlar, polycarbonate offers decent impact resistance and is lighter than fiberglass, making it a solid option for entry-level racers.
- Expanded Polystyrene (EPS) Foam: EPS foam is commonly used as the inner lining of helmets for energy absorption during impacts. While it is not a structural material, its ability to compress and dissipate energy helps reduce the risk of head injuries during a crash.
